Abstract

LKPD digunakan sebagai suatu bahan ajar yang dapat membantu dan mempermudah dalam proses pembelajaran. Penelitian ini bertujuan untuk mengetahui struktur, kelayakan dan kepraktisan LKPD berbasis SSCS (Search, Solve, Create and Share). Metode penelitian yang digunakan adalah R & D dengan model Borg & Gall. Subjek penelitian adalah Guru dan 29 orang peserta didik kelas XI SMA Negeri 01 Kota Bengkulu. Hasil penilaian validasi keseluruhan aspek pada bahan ajar LKPD Biologi berbasis SSCS materi sistem pernapasan yang dikembangkan memiliki kelayakan sangat baik dengan persentase 86,41%. LKPD yang dikembangkan dikategorikan sangat praktis, semua aspek penilaian yang diberikan melalui lembar respon peserta didik mendapatkan hasil dengan persentase 100%, peserta didik memberikan respon yang baik terhadap LKPD yang dikembangkan. Hasil belajar peserta didik menunjukan bahwa LKPD Biologi berbasis SSCS mampu memfasilitasi pengetahuan faktual, konseptual dan prosedural peserta didik dengan memperoleh persentase sebesar 92.09%.

ABSTRACT This research is research development ( R &D) which aims to describe the characteristics of learning resources in the form of student worksheets based on scientific literacy and to find out the feasibility of the student worksheets and to find out student responses to the developed scientific literacy-based student worksheets. From this research resulted of student worksheets based on science literature on nutrition materials for class VIII which can make students interested in learning and easier to understand a material. This development research was carried out using a 4D model (define, design, development,dan disseminate) limited to 3D (define, design, development). For the feasibility of the experts using the AIken v formula and reliability. The data comes from a validation process by design experts, materials experts, and linguists. From the recapitulation results obtained from the data for expert agreement, it shows that the criteria are valid and for reliability is in the very good category. Abstract

This study produced an android-based e-module for Basic Biology course on Biotechnology material to support online learning. This study is a research and development using ADDIE model. Data were collected by using questionnaires and interviews, while the data analysis technique using qualitative and quantitative descriptive. The developed e-module was then validated by validators from teaching material experts. The readability test was carried out to 30 students. The results of this study revealed that the android-based e-module on Biotechnology material was valid. While the student readability test assessment revealed that the medium was very good. Thus, the e-module developed is feasible implemented in class for online learning.

Abstract

This study aims to develop LKPD oriented contextual approach to the material adaptation of living things to their environment class VI and to describe the feasibility and responses of users (teachers and students). The research was conducted at SDN Muara Kuis  Muratara in  class  VI.  This  research is  a  research and  development research with  the  Four  D  (4D)  model. The object  of  this  research is  LKPD with contextual approach orientation. The research stages are define, design, develop and disseminate. The instrument used is a feasibility test questionnaire and teacher interviews and student questionnaires. The feasibility test was carried out by 6 validators, namely 2 material experts, 2 language experts and 2 display experts. The user response test was carried out on 15 grade VI students and 1 teacher at SDN Muara Kuis Muratara. Data analysis used percentage technique and processed descriptively. The contextual elements in the LKPD are relating (connecting), experiencing (experience), applying (application), cooperating (working together), and transfering (moving). The results of the LKPD feasibility test are contextually oriented by  the  validator in  terms  of  material aspects, language aspects  and  presentation aspects. Feasibility of the material obtained 0.81 (very feasible), language 0.66 (feasible criteria), display 0.80 (very feasible). The results of the test using the LKPD oriented contextual approach, a response was obtained that the LKPD had met the needs of teachers to be used as teaching materials to support science learning in class VI and received positive criteria by students on aspects of LKPD material quality, LKPD display  aspects,  aspects  of  material  presentation,  and  aspects  of  LKPD.  benefits through  the  distribution  of  questionnaires.  It  can  be  concluded  that  the  use  of contextual approach-oriented LKPD is feasible and positive to be used as teaching material in grade VI SD.

Abstract

Abstract This study aims to describe the development, feasibility, and determine the effectiveness of the AKM-oriented HOTS question formulation module in elementary science subjects and to determine student literacy achievements in answering AKM-oriented HOTS questions in elementary science subjects. This research is a development research using the ADDIE model. Analysis of teacher needs for the module, initial module design, module development, module implementation, and evaluation. Data were collected through surveys, documentary analysis, teacher response interviews, and student literacy tests. The survey was conducted using a questionnaire to determine the teacher's needs for the HOTS question preparation module. The instruments used are expert validation instruments, question analysis instruments, and test instruments to determine student literacy achievements. The results of this study are the compilation of HOTS questions that are feasible to use as evidenced by the value of the material expert's reliability test results of 0.58, media experts 0.435, and linguists 0.696. The module is effective for improving the ability of teachers in preparing HOTS questions as evidenced by the T-Test score with a significance level of 0.04 (p < 0.05).

Abstract

The purpose of this study is to develop, describe the level of feasibility, determine user responses and determine the effectiveness of digital teaching materials based on discovery learning with augmented reality to improve students' critical thinking skills. The type of research used is research and development. The research model in the development of teaching materials is the ADDIE model. The types of data used are quantitative and qualitative data using instruments in the form of interviews, needs analysis questionnaires, questions, expert validation sheets and user response questionnaires. Based on the results of the study, it can be concluded that the teaching materials developed are suitable for use as teaching materials in the Natural Sciences (IPA) class V material for animal and human movement organs. Aspects that are validated include the feasibility of the material, language, and design. The percentage of material expert validation results is 71%. From the validation of linguists 83% and the validation of design experts 90%. The user's response is very good because the results of the questionnaire analysis of class V students' responses from students, aspects of continuity of content are 83%, aspects of design are 83% and aspects of material interest are 80%. The teaching materials developed are effective in improving the critical thinking skills of fifth grade students at SDN 107 Bengkulu Utara. This is based on the results of the effect size test of 93.33%.

Abstract

This study aims to describe the cognitive appearance and quality of empirical questions about school exams. This type of research is descriptive quantitative research. The subject of this research is a matter of school exams for science subjects. The object of research is the description and quality of the items empirically. The research instrument was in the form of an analysis of the percentage level of knowledge and quality of items empirically. The research data were analyzed using proportions calculated by percentage and rater agreement as well as student scores tested for validity, reliability, level of difficulty, and discriminatory power. The results showed that: 1) The percentage of questions at Level 1 was 52.50%. At Level 2, 22.50% is less than the ideal standard of BSNP. At Level 3 of 25%, and 2) The quality of the items empirically, the results of the validity of 22 questions are valid and 18 questions are not valid, the results of the reliability test are 0.629, the difficulty level test is 5 easy questions (12.5%), 27 questions moderate (67.5%) and 8 difficult questions (20%,) the results of the discriminatory test were 25 bad questions (62.5%) and 15 questions were sufficient (37.5%). Thus, the quality of the science test items for grade VI students of SDN Pendopo, Empat Lawang Regency 2020/2021 is not good, judging from the comparison of the level of knowledge and quality empirically.

Abstract

This study aims to describe the development, feasibility, and response of students to STEM-Based LKPD with Theme 8 Bumiku for Class VI in Science Subjects. The type of research is research and development by modifying the Sugiyono model adopting 6 steps, namely potential problems, planning information gathering, product design, design validation, product revision, product testing. Research data obtained through questionnaires, interview guidelines, validation sheets, and student responses. Aspects that are validated include the feasibility of the material, language, presentation and graphics. The results of the research and development show that: 1) STEM-based LKPD was developed through six stages of development, namely the potential problem stage, information gathering, planning, product design, design validation, product revision, limited trial; STEM-based worksheets meet the feasibility in the aspects of material, language, presentation, and graphics that are suitable for use in learning because on average each feasibility obtains valid results and the reliability is very strong; 3) The response of the STEM-based LKPD is very good because the relationship between science and mathematics content has been integrated quite well. Based on the results of research and development, it is concluded that STEM-based worksheets are very suitable for use in learning science content for grade VI elementary school students.
